LUBOFOSKA® 3,5-14-16 NPK fertilizer

WITH COPPER AND MANGANESE

EK Fertilizer • GRANULATED • B.1.1. TYPE

NNPK (Ca, S) 3,5-14-16- (10-19) WITH COPPER (Cu) 0.10 AND MANGANESE (Mn) 0.2

  1. Perfect for potassium-rich soils, especially winter rape, sugar beet, corn plantations and grasslands
  2. for cereal plantations it can be used for all soil types
  3. if the soil is deficient in potassium, it provides an excellent basis for further fertilization of this trace element
  4. takes into account the different nutrient needs of different plant species for secondary ingredients: sulfur for rapeseed, copper for wheat, manganese for barley and beets
  5. in addition to the basic function of all secondary components, their main role is to stimulate the efficiency-increasing efficiency of nitrogen yields
  6. simultaneously provides plants with sulfur, manganese and copper and increases plant resistance to pathogens, regardless of the type of plantation
  7. excellent sowing properties

GRANULATION AND VOLUME DENSITY

It contains at least 92% of particles between 2.0 and 5.0 mm in size.

Bulk density: between 1.0 and 1.05 kg / dcm3

 

FEATURES


3.5%    ammonium nitrogen (N)

14%     phosphorus pentoxide (P₂O₅) is soluble in mineral acids

12%     phosphorus pentoxide (P₂O₅) soluble in neutral ammonium citrate solution and water

11%     phosphorus pentoxide (P₂O₅) is soluble in water

16%     potassium oxide (K₂O) is soluble in water

10%     calcium oxide (CaO) is soluble in water

19%     total sulfur trioxide (SO₃)

0.1%    total copper (Cu)

0.2%    total manganese (Mn)

USE

It is recommended to fertilize before sowing, but not later than 7 days before sowing. After use, the fertilizer must be mixed with the soil to a depth of 10 cm. In permanent grasslands as well as in the case of intervention fertilization, fertilization can also be carried out during the vegetation cycle of the plants. The fertilizer dose should be adjusted to the yield and the phosphorus content of the soil.
